Hi Jonathan, What we've implemented for 1.5 is a pseudo-pagination, where we bring all the data in from the back end in one go, cache it and then display it a page at a time. REGISTRY-447 is still open to provide paged retrieval from the registry, so I reopened MASHUP-734 to track the associated changes on our side, once registry gives us this support.
